Component: MM
Component Name: Materials Management
Description: A scheduling agreement used to request or instruct a plant to transport material from one plant to another that is, to effect a long distance physical stock transfer within the same enterprise. The stock transport scheduling agreement allows delivery costs incurred as a result of the stock transfer to be charged to the material transported.
Key Concepts: A Stock Transport Scheduling Agreement (STSA) is a type of contract in SAP Materials Management (MM) that allows for the transfer of goods from one plant to another. It is used to define the terms and conditions of the transfer, such as the quantity, delivery date, and price. The STSA also serves as a reference document for the goods movement. How to use it: The STSA is created in SAP MM by entering the relevant details such as the plants involved, the material to be transferred, and the delivery date. Once created, it can be used to create a goods movement document for the transfer of goods. The STSA can also be used to monitor the progress of the transfer and ensure that all conditions are met.
